Custody Technician - We Will Train You
Kootenai County Sheriff's Office – Kootenai County Jail
Position Summary
This position supports Detention Deputies during the inmate booking and release process. Duties include direct contact with inmates, maintaining and updating inmate records, and performing various jail-related clerical tasks. The position also requires operating the jail's control systems, including doors, gates, video surveillance, and intercom systems, requiring strong hand-eye coordination and attention to detail.
Compensation & Benefits
Starting Pay: $22.96 per hour DOE (includes $0.50 shift differential)
Retirement:
Public Employees Retirement System of Idaho (PERSI)Pension plan with 5-year vesting
11.96% employer contribution
Lifetime payout upon retirement
Healthcare:
Comprehensive benefits package, including access for employees and dependents to a free medical clinic offering:Primary care appointments
Medications
Lab services
Additional healthcare services
Student Loan Forgiveness:
This position qualifies for the Public Service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F) Program, allowing eligible employees to receive 100% student loan forgiveness.

Minimum Qualifications
Possess a high school diploma or GED
Have at least six (6) months of work experience
Possess or be able to obtain NCIC (National Crime Information Center) certification within six (6) months of hire
Be able to carry and use pepper spray
